The Nebraska Department of Correctional Services’ (NDCS) mission is:  'Keep people safe.'

The agency operates nine prisons in five communities in Nebraska.

It is the second largest state agency and employs approximately 2,300 team members in more than 150 different job classifications.

 
"NDCS has a national reputation for being innovative and focused on reentry and rehabilitation.”
